Assimilation: Indonesian Journal of Biology Education
ISSN : -     EISSN : 26217260     DOI : -
Core Subject : Education,
AIJBE published a scientific paper on the results of the study/research and review of the literature in the sphere of biology education includes: learning strategy, learning media, assessment, teaching materials, curriculum, and teacher professional development. AIJBE covers many research in all level of education (primary, secondary, and higher education). The publication frequency is twice a year in March and September.

Effect of concept mapping instructional strategy on senior secondary school students’ retention level in biology in Kwara State Oyeyemi, Waheed Tunde; Olorundare, Adekunle Solomon; Bolaji, Hameed Olalekan

Cell Division topic in Biology is often challenging for students due to poor understanding. The study investigated how concept mapping impacts the retention of senior secondary school biology students in Kwara State, Nigeria. Using a quasi-experimental design with 77 students from two public junior high schools. The design is suitable due to its limitations, such as the inability to assign participants and the use of pre-existing groups randomly. Data was collected using Biology Concept Map Instructional Strategy for Teaching Cell Division and Biology Performing Test. The instruments were validated by experts and tested on 40 students. The results showed a significant difference in retention levels between male and female students when teaching Cell Division using this strategy (p0.05). It is recommended that Biology teachers prioritize the use of Computer-Machine Interfaces when teaching Cell Division, particularly for students with low retention and female students. The concept mapping instructional strategy significantly improves students' retention levels in Cell Division Biology, particularly among female students. It also indicates that gender is greatly influenced by this strategy, with females showing higher retention rates. Therefore, it suggests that using this approach in senior secondary school biology education can significantly enhance retention rates.
Application of jigsaw cooperative learning type based on socio-scientific issues to improve argumentation skills on nervous system material Mardiyah, Fitri Husni; Suhara, Suhara; Gemilawati, Meilia

The use of a jigsaw type cooperative learning model based on socioscientific issues in nervous system material can be used as a way to provide students with argumentation skills. This research aims to obtain information regarding the application of jigsaw type cooperative learning based on socioscientific issues in improving students' argumentation skills regarding the nervous system. This research uses classroom action research methods. The sample in this study was class XI students consisting of 36 people. The results of this research show that there is a significant difference in the average between before and after action research in argumentation skills. In cycle 1, the pretest score achieved argumentation level 1 (score 64.36), while in the posttest score achieved argumentation level 2 (score 72.75). After treatment in cycle 2, namely the application of jigsaw type cooperative learning based on socioscientific issues, it was able to improve students' argumentation skills. The posttest score achieved argumentation level of 3 (score 76.17) becomes a score of 80.39 with an argumentation level of 4. So, based on this classroom action research, the application of jigsaw type cooperative learning based on socioscientific issues and improves students' argumentation skills in nervous system material.
High school students’ cognitive load on biology learning: A case study Sunandar, Aris; Karwatisari, Rina; Rahmat, Adi; Winarno, Nanang; Hamdiyati, Yanti

This study aimed to analyze the cognitive load of high school students on biology learning. The method was used in this research is the survey method. The subjects of the study consisted of 179 students in grade X students consisting of 56 male students and 123 female students, 130 students in grade XI consisting of 37 male students and 93 female students, and 90 students in grade XII students consisting of 30 male students and 60 female students. The instrument in this study used a questionnaire cognitive load theory proposed by Meissner and Bogner about good learning design with a Likert scale. The results of research on high school students' cognitive load in biology revealed a medium average of 2.93, with GCL (3.29) ranking highest, followed by ICL (2.85) and ECL (2.66). The data processing results with the Kruskal Wallis test was showed that each factor has differences between ICL, ECL, and GCL. Thus, high school students still have a cognitive load when studying in class. The data processing results with the Mann U Whitney test to analyze the difference in cognitive load between male and female students was showed no significant difference between male and female students in cognitive load on biology learning.
Analysis and reconstruction of student worksheets based on vee diagrams of biotechnology concept Tamba, Rhodentia Sri Hastuti; Supriatno, Bambang

Planning is needed in practicum to connect students' conceptual and procedural knowledge through well-structured of student worksheets (SW). This can be achieved by using the Vee diagram. Vee diagram is a model that describes the relationship between conceptual and procedural understanding in building scientific knowledge. Through Vee diagrams, students can learn that knowledge comes from events/problem objects. This study aims to analyze and reconstruction student worksheets on Biotechnology concepts focused on making yogurt in several High School Biology textbooks. Method of this study is a descriptive-qualitative method through the stages of ANCOR (Analysis, Trial and Reconstruction). Samples were taken using a purposive method. Research shows that based on results of analysis of 6 student worksheets from various publishers referring to aspects of relevance to the curriculum, structural, practical, and knowledge construction aspects of Vee diagrams, respectively, 71%, 68%, 79% (good category) and 50% (fairly good category). Thus, it can be concluded that in general, the student worksheets are not sufficiently capable of meeting the demands of the curriculum and assisting students in constructing knowledge. Therefore, it is necessary to reconstruct and develop student worksheets that have been analyzed and tested to produce better student worksheet that fulfill every aspect specified above.
The effect of PjBL, PBL, and STEM learning methods on student learning outcomes on photosynthesis material Silaban, Oky Rizkiana; Surakusumah, Wahyu; Sanjaya, Yayan

Photosynthesis is a vital process in the biological world which is the basis for the survival of plants. It is important to ensure that the learning methods used are able to provide students with a deep understanding and encourage the development of critical and creative thinking skills in accordance with the demands of the independent curriculum. Several methods offer learning approaches that focus on applying theoretical concepts in practical contexts, such as PJBL, PBL, STEM and Conventional methods. It is hoped that this research can contribute to improving the quality of high school biology learning by providing insight into the effectiveness of different learning methods. The research method used is a Quasi Experimental method with a Posttest Only Design type. The research sample was four high school XII science (IPA) classes using purposive sampling. The results of the hypothesis test show that the Sig. less than 0.05, so it rejects Ho and accepts H1, that there are differences in learning outcomes using PJBL, PBL, STEM and conventional methods. Based on the mean rank, it was found that the STEM method was better than the PJBL, PBL and conventional methods.
Environmental literacy research trends in education: A systematic literature review Rofiqi, Ainur

Environmental literacy is a key concept in promoting individual attitudes towards conscious lifestyle changes towards environmental challenges in a sustainable manner. This research is a systematic literature review by analyzing articles from 2018-April 2023 with environmental literacy in education as the main focus. This study aims to collect information related to various studies on environmental literacy in education in Indonesia. The results showed an increase in publication trends, the dominant research was quantitative research, besides that grade 7 and 10 students became the most subjects. Tests and percentage analysis are instruments and methods of data analysis used successively, and the most treatment is in the form of environmental literacy tests. The recommendations proposed for the next research are increasing the diversity of research types, research subjects, as well as the selection of appropriate instruments and data analysis.
Influence of social media applications on pre-service biology teachers’ learning outcomes in Kwara State college of education, Oro, Nigeria Adeoye, Gabriel Ademakinwa; Adewumi, Gabriel Segun

This study examined the influence of social media applications on pre-service Biology teachers’ learning outcomes in Kwara State College of Education, Oro, Nigeria. The sample comprised sixty pre-service teachers who were drawn using purposive sampling technique from NCE 3 of the 2021/2022 set. Questionnaire was used for data collection while the data gathered were analyzed using mean, standard deviation and t-test statistical tool at a mean benchmark of 2.50. Findings from the study revealed that WhatsApp, Facebook, Instagram and YouTube are the commonly used social media applications by pre-service Biology teachers which are usually accessed through mobile phones and tablets. Further finding indicates that pre-service Biology teachers use social media applications daily but more during the night hours. There was also a significant difference between social media application usage and pre-service Biology teachers study habits in Kwara State College of Education, Oro, Nigeria t(118) = 2.39, p = .02. The study concluded that pre-service Biology teachers use social media and it is affecting their study habits, and in turn their learning outcomes. It is therefore, recommended that the college should provide adequate training to equip pre-service teachers with necessary skills to maximize the utilization of social media applications to boost their learning outcomes.
